If this has come up before (quite likely . . .) I apologize. I tried a quick search, but may have overlooked something.

I have an SKS "Cowboy's Companion" carbine, purchased several years ago, that has a small rail mounted on the left side of the receiver. Someone once told me it was for use in conjunction with some type of scope mount, but I can't find any additional details.

Anyone know what type of mount, where I might find one, etc.? :confused:

Thanks in advance!:D
 
Haven't seen one but here's my guess. Sounds like a typical side rail for mounting an AK-type scope arrangement. I think the folks that make Saigas (eaacorp.com? I think) and Robinson Arms (the folks that make VEPR's) sell the scope mount itself. I'm sure there are others. Do a search for AK scope mounts and I think you'll see that mount you're looking for.

Riphalman, Railroader and Murphster; appreciate the info & input. It looks like I may be out of luck trying to find one of the original mounts, at least through normal channels (I don't do e-bay).

I did find a Millett website (www.millettsights.com) that lists a "scout-type" mount for the SKS (they have models for AKs, too) that replaces the rear sight blade. Millett is a reputable company, so I plan to give this a try. A scout setup with a low-power handgun scope should be ideal for a stubby SKS.:D
 
The biggest beef I have heard with the Scout mount on an SKS is that the scope and/or mount must be removed to clean the gas system.
